Over 5000 people of all the parts of the Jewish community celebrated Chanukah together at the 28th grand Menorah lighting of Chabad Lubavitch of Argentina.
Chief Rabbi of Israel, Rabbi Shlomo Amar, who is visiting the Argentine Jewish community, was honored with lighting the 1st candle, and shared an inspiring Chanukah message with the assembled crowd.
Many dignitaries, government officials, and leaders of the Jewish community were in attendance, including the Israeli Ambassador of Argentina Mrs. Dorit Shavit, Buenos Aires Cabinet Chief Horacio Rodríguez Larreta, philanthropist Mr. Eduardo Elsztain and Rabbi Chaim Lapidus.
Head Shliach of Argentina, Rabbi Tzvi Grunblatt, uplifted the crowd with a message of hope, strength and Jewish pride.
Music by Rabbi Daniel Zelione accompanied by the KEF orchestra had the crowd on their feet dancing and celebrating for hours.
The event was arranged by Rabbi Shike Birman, Mr. Shaul Hochberger, and Mr. Matias Diner of Chabad Lubavitch Argentina directed by Rabbi Tzvi Grunblatt.
